Coming Up on Africa News Tonight: ➡️ A South African magistrates court Friday granted bail to seven South African men accused of killing Zimbabwean national Elvis Nyathi, who fell victim to a vigilant group last month, who were conducting a door-to-door exercise seeking out undocumented migrants and criminals; AND... Namibian police Friday arrested an opposition party leader, Michael Amushelelo of the National Economic Freedom Fighters party, a day after he led a group into Windhoek’s China Town district, forcing shops to close.
